## Authentication

The Glacierbin archiver authenticates to the storage control plane with a bearer credential injected at deploy time. Never commit it; rotate quarterly via the Hollis vault job. Local development uses the sandbox tenant only. For sandbox runs, export the token below.

session JWT of yawep-yawep = eyJhbGciOiJIUzI1NiIsInR5cCI6IkpXVCJ9.eyJzdWIiOiI3pWF3_In0.aXYsHiog

Gross margin slipped 1.8 points year over year, driven mainly by freight surcharges and markdowns on the Arlow home range. The Pellworth and Grayden branches outperformed thanks to tighter shrink controls, which we intend to standardise. Corrective pricing actions are drafted and will be circulated for comment before approval. Please review carefully before Thursday. The confidential note on forward business plans follows immediately below.

— Corin Hale, Finance Director

internal memo for hafog-hadug: The pricing group signed off on a budget of $16.1 million for Project Gorir. The renewal with Oliionax Systems closes at $14.1 million a year, 46 percent above the last contract.

Quarterly Planning Note — Divestiture of the Coastal Tooling Unit

For the finance team: the sale of the Coastal Tooling unit to Pellmark Industries remains on track for close in Q3. Please finalize the carve-out balance sheet, reconcile intercompany positions, and prepare the working-capital adjustment schedule by month-end. Audit support requests should be prioritized. For planning purposes, note the following sensitive item:

internal memo for hawef-kahif: The finance team signed off on a budget of $25.9 million for Project Sorox. The renewal with Pelokek Logistics closes at $51.7 million a year, 52 percent below the last contract.